1. Penetration Testing of an In-Vehicle Infotainment System
University essay from KTH/Skolan för elektroteknik och datavetenskap (EECS)Abstract : With the growing demand for smart and luxurious vehicles, the automotive industry has moved toward developing technologies to enhance the in-vehicle user experience. As a result, most vehicles today have a so-called In-Vehicle Infotainment (IVI) system, or simply an infotainment system, which provides a combination of information and entertainment in one system. 3. Technologies and Evaluation Metrics for On-Board Over the Air Control
University essay from Uppsala universitet/Institutionen för informationsteknologiAbstract : This project has been carried out at the Electronic Embedded Systems Architecture Department at Volvo Construction Equipment (VCE), Eskilstuna, Sweden. It forms the baseline for a stepwise systematic research initiative to convert wired technologies used for certain in-vehicle control and communication components to wireless technologies. READ MORE

4. Automated advanced analytics on vehicle data using AI
University essay from KTH/FordonsdynamikAbstract : The evolution of electrification and autonomous driving on automotive leads to the increasing complexity of the in-vehicle electrical network, which poses a new challenge for testers to do troubleshooting work in massive log files. This thesis project aims to develop a predictive technique for anomaly detection focusing on user function level failures using machine learning technologies. READ MORE
